## Capacity note: Fargate rules engine for Tallowline shipping fees

For review context: the fee rules engine evaluates roughly 40 rules per quote, and evaluation is CPU-bound with no external calls, so the security surface is limited to the rule-upload path. We size pods assuming peak quote traffic during the Westdell promo windows, with a 2x headroom margin. Rule cache entries are signed at upload and verified on load. The limits below bound memory growth and cap rule complexity; please confirm they match the threat model assumptions.

tuning table, yajog-yahof:
BUDGETS = {
    "lamvan": 303,
    "wenox": 460,
    "fenvan": 525,
}

# Break-Glass: Catalog Cache Invalidation

Scope: the Pinrow product catalog at Veldstone Retail. If stale prices persist after a purge and the Hollowmere invalidation queue is wedged, use break-glass to flush the edge tier directly. Contractors: get verbal sign-off from the catalog lead first. Steps: open the Hollowmere admin shell, select emergency-flush, confirm the tenant, and run it once — repeated flushes thrash the origin. Access is logged and expires after 20 minutes. Unseal the admin shell with the passphrase below.

recovery phrase for kahop-tajog: istix-casvan

Hi Dariela,

Handing over the EXIF scrubbing pipeline before my leave. Uploaded images pass through the `scrub_worker` pool, which removes all metadata except orientation and writes a per-file audit row to the `scrub_ledger` table. Do not truncate that table; compliance relies on it for quarterly attestations. Retries are idempotent — duplicate rows are deduped by content hash nightly. If you need to verify scrub coverage manually, query the ledger database using the connection string below.

Thanks,
Osmund

primary connection of tawif-yajeg = postgresql://rusiel_svc:G879q9cx6GsSvj@db-dd9f.norvagrid.internal:5432/casath

**Mgmt Meeting Minutes — Retiring the Brightline Range**

Quick recap for sales leads at Fenholt Supplies: we agreed to retire the Brightline fixture range by year-end. Remaining stock moves to clearance pricing next month, and accounts on standing orders get migrated to the Lumetta range. Trade-in incentives were approved in principle. The confidential note on next steps sits just below.

board note of bajof-bajeg: The pricing group signed off on a budget of $13.4 million for Project Sildor. The renewal with Lamixek Holdings closes at $48.9 million a year, 49 percent above the last contract.